Output 664fcbe89e82f277a810199490ef8ef5feca730eb31ec806614def7045633177:0

value
152316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f5154e11ba10afe22b8773e177913d428d267e8 OP_EQUAL
address
3BqcMrR1A1krNi6z6bcdqRTgrkfocuJzii
transaction
664fcbe89e82f277a810199490ef8ef5feca730eb31ec806614def7045633177
spent
true